My mother wishes to move out of her home into sheltered housing. Because she has savings in excess of £6K she will be liable for rent in the residence of her choice, so she wants to offload the surplus into an account of mine to look after on her behalf.
a) is this legal?
b) I am/ is she liable for any tax?
c) given that the sum involved is £51k currently held in two Halifax accounts, where should I invest it to get the best return and still have reasonable access should she require any of it to spend? :confused:

Comments

  • a) is this legal?
    No. (Thus rendering your other two questions unanswerable.)

    It's called deliberate deprivation, and your mother would still be liable to pay any fees/rent.
